What It Computes

Prime Counts

Compares exact browser-capped prime counts with the simple `n / log(n)` approximation.

Zero Diagnostics

Records numerical zeta-zero and spacing diagnostics in Python experiments where configured.

Coefficient Signals

Explores Keiper-Li-style numerical signals as search diagnostics, subject to precision limits.

Numerical diagnostics can suggest what to inspect. They do not prove the Riemann Hypothesis.
